Client Brief

A local newlywed couple were handed down this apartment by their parents as a wedding gift. Both are avid travellers: the husband enjoys photography and has a photography collection, while the wife loves entertaining.

“They wanted a space that felt good, positive, open, relaxing, worldly, and suitable for entertaining their friends over hotpot. They also wanted to showcase their collection of fine vintage cameras and photos they’ve taken during their travels,” said JJ Acuna, the creative mind behind the project.

“They’re not considering having children at this stage, but they do want the flexibility to have an extra bedroom where they can host their elderly parents or friends. Eventually, this room could be transformed into a child’s room. Currently, the extra bedroom functions as a hobby room that doubles as their home office.

Reconfiguration

The apartment has been reconfigured from three bedrooms, two full bathrooms, and a maid’s room into two bedrooms, two full bathrooms, and a maid’s room.

Concept & Style

The team aimed for a detail-oriented space that reflects “easy modern coastal luxury”. “Basically, it’s a relaxing and calming home that radiates positive energy, practicality, and makes the most of natural daylight,” Acuna said.

The design features a clean palette with soft tones, tingling timber details, neutral furnishings, and coastal textures and accents, complemented by touches of rustic finishes.

Challenges

One challenge was to make an old building – with its vintage units, limited window openings, and low ceiling height – feel spacious and airy.

Solutions

The team ensured the home reflected as much daylight as possible by using various shades of whites, beiges, and creams, and by lacquering surfaces to the right degree so that light could shine off the different materials.

They also aimed to play with patterns, textures, knotting, and natural colours that reflect light instead of absorbing it. To enhance the feeling of openness, the team broke down as many walls as possible to create a seamless flow and connection from one room to another.

Tips:

  • Try lacquered surfaces on the ceiling to make a low ceiling height feel much taller. That is if you don’t want to put mirrors on the ceiling.

  • The dining table has loose chairs on one side and a dining bench on the other. This was because the space wasn’t enough for loose dining chairs on both sides, so a bench was the best way to save space and you can come in from the side and you don’t have to pull the seat backwards.

  • Another opportunity to make a small space feel larger is to do a printed wall covering on the ceiling. The team decided to go this route with the powder room to give this room a sense of height and charm.

  • The firm always attempts to make a boring wall feel more interesting, and this time it designed a planked timber wall painted in eggshell warm white to make one long wall surface within the kitchen, living and dining area feel a bit more interesting, intimate, and lived in.

  • The headboard of the master bedroom is adjacent to the only window in the space, so instead of making curtains, Acuna decided to fabricate sliding slatted screens for the windows so daylight can enter while still having a bit of strong architecture at the same time.
